'It's the two best things in the world: food and sex.'
Slutty Cheff is an anonymous London chef who knows what it's really like to work in the capital's hectic restaurant scene.

From working sixty-hour weeks in windowless kitchens and being the only woman in the changing room to the pure thrill of a busy service, falling in love with other chefs and cycling home through a city bubbling over with potential, Slutty Cheff's misadventures in food and sex are about experiencing and embracing life to the fullest. The pleasure and the chaos included . . .
